Frequently asked questions
Economic downturns can lead to decreased demand and lower resale values for vehicles, as buyers may defer purchasing vehicles or opt for less expensive alternatives.
The window sticker plays a crucial role in the car buying process by ensuring transparency about the vehicle's features, costs, and certifications, aiding consumers in making informed purchasing decisions.
Yes, in many cases, you can determine the type of drivetrain a 2007 CHEVROLET SILVERADO 1500 has from its VIN if the manufacturer encodes this information within the VIN.
Our reports may track major service milestones such as brake rotor replacements, detailing when and how often they have occurred, if this information is recorded.
A salvage title generally indicates that the vehicle was declared a total loss by an insurance company due to severe damage from an accident, flood, or other causes, if such information is recorded.
The expected depreciation of a vehicle after three years can vary, but generally, cars lose a significant portion of their value within the first few years.
The average depreciation rate for vehicles over five years can vary, but many models experience a significant portion of their depreciation within the first few years of ownership.
The window sticker for 2007 CHEVROLET vehicles provides emissions information including compliance with federal or state standards and the vehicle's environmental impact ratings.
Yes, by law, all new 2007 CHEVROLET vehicles are required to display a Monroney label to provide clear pricing and feature information to consumers.
